Broken tile replacement services involve removing damaged or cracked tiles and installing new ones to restore the appearance and integrity of tiled surfaces. This process typically includes carefully removing the affected tiles without damaging surrounding materials, preparing the underlying surface for new tile installation, and then securely setting and grouting the replacement tiles. The goal is to ensure a seamless look that matches the existing tile work, helping to improve both the aesthetic appeal and functionality of the space.

This service addresses a variety of common problems, such as cracked, chipped, or loose tiles caused by impact, wear and tear, or shifting foundations. It can also help fix issues resulting from water damage, mold, or improper installation that leads to tiles falling out or becoming unstable. Replacing broken tiles not only enhances the visual appearance of a room but also prevents further damage to the underlying surfaces, which can lead to more costly repairs if left unaddressed.

Broken tile replacement is often needed in residential properties, including kitchens, bathrooms, entryways, and laundry rooms, where tiled surfaces are frequently used. It is also common in commercial spaces like retail stores, restaurants, and office buildings that feature tiled floors or walls. Homeowners and property managers turn to local contractors to handle these repairs because they require skillful removal and precise installation to ensure the new tiles match the existing work and maintain the overall look.

The overview below groups typical Broken Tile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- for minor broken tiles,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, covering simple replacements or repairs of a few tiles. Larger, more complex projects can exceed this range but are less common in this category.

Partial Replacement - replacing several damaged tiles or a small section of a tiled area usually costs between $600 and $1,500. This range accounts for most projects involving moderate damage or localized repairs. Costs may increase if additional surface preparation or matching is required.

Full Tile Replacement - when an entire tiled area needs replacement, local service providers often quote between $1,500 and $3,500. Many projects in this category are standard-sized areas, but larger or more intricate installations can push costs higher.

Complete Floor or Wall Overhaul - larger, more complex tile replacement projects, such as entire floors or walls, can reach $5,000 or more. These jobs are less frequent and involve significant surface work, custom matching, or specialty tiles, which increase overall costs.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es tiles to break or crack? Tile damage can result from impacts, shifting foundations, or improper installation, leading to cracks or breaks over time.

Can broken tiles be replaced without damaging surrounding tiles? Yes, experienced contractors can carefully remove and replace damaged tiles to minimize impact on surrounding areas.

Is it necessary to replace all tiles in a damaged area? Not necessarily; a professional can assess whether individual tiles can be replaced or if a larger section needs attention.

What types of tiles can be replaced through these services? Services typically handle various tile types, including ceramic, porcelain, and natural stone, depending on the contractor.

How do contractors match new tiles to existing ones? Local service providers often use matching techniques based on tile color, pattern, and texture to ensure a seamless repair.
